The Subgingival Scaler Single End #SEC2 is a specialized dental instrument used primarily for the scaling and cleaning of the root surfaces beneath the gumline, a procedure essential for maintaining gum health and treating periodontal disease. This scaler is designed with a single-ended blade that is perfect for precise and effective removal of calculus, plaque, and debris from subgingival areas, which are areas beneath the gumline that are difficult to reach with regular scaling instruments.

Functions and Usage:
Subgingival scalers, including the #SEC2, are used as part of the scaling and root planing (SRP) procedure, a fundamental treatment for gum disease. SRP aims to clean the teeth and roots below the gumline, smoothing out rough surfaces and removing bacterial buildup, which can contribute to gum inflammation and infection. Using the #SEC2 scaler, dental professionals can remove calculus that might not be accessible using traditional scaling tools. The shape of the blade enables the practitioner to follow the contours of the root surfaces, ensuring effective debridement and preparation for tissue healing.
The scaler is especially helpful when working in deeper pockets (4 mm or more) where other instruments might not provide adequate access. The ability to comfortably work within the subgingival area without causing unnecessary irritation is a significant advantage in treating periodontal disease and maintaining optimal oral health.
